Sir Frank Brangwyn
1867‐1956
British painter, printmaker, and designer. Born in Bruges, Belgium, he lived in London from the age of seven. He trained under his architect father and under W. Morris. He mainly painted impressionist-style landscapes, but later received many commissions for murals and developed a stronger decorative tendency. He was commissioned to decorate S. Bing's shop in Paris, and also designed furniture and stained glass for commercial use. During World War I, he produced posters as a war artist. He was also friends with Kojiro Matsukata, and at his request, he designed the art museum he envisioned in Azabu, Tokyo (1920).

1867‐1956
イギリスの画家,版画家,デザイナー。ベルギーのブリュージュに生まれ,7歳よりロンドンに住む。建築家の父およびW.モリスの下で修業。印象派風の風景画を主とするが,のちに壁画の注文を多く受け,装飾的傾向を強める。パリのS.ビングの店の装飾を依頼され,また商品としての家具やステンドグラスのデザインを行う。第1次大戦中は戦争画家としてポスターを制作。また,松方幸次郎と親交があり,彼の依頼で,東京・麻布に構想された美術館の設計(1920)も手がけている。
